Block

#22,313,103
Block Number
22,313,103 @ 07/27/2025, 23:54:10
Status
Finalized
ID
0x0154788f0a6655ea764c4e98f28cae97ddae93e52a37a78f0014f16907d11798
Transactions
Gas Used
10522787/40000000 (26.31% Used)
Base Fee
10,000 Gwei
Total Score
2,179,010,924 (+100)
Rewards
3.71 VTHO